The development and application of geochemical techniques to identify redox conditions in
modern and ancient aquatic environments has intensified over recent years. Iron (Fe)
speciation has emerged as one of the most widely used procedures to distinguish different
redox regimes in both the water column and sediments, and is the main technique used to
identify oxic, ferruginous (anoxic, Fe (II) containing) and euxinic (anoxic, sulfidic) water
